Precision Engineered: How Ansix Tech Masters PET Cylindrical Cover Flange Manufacturing

In the competitive world of precision injection molding, where margins are measured in microns and efficiency in seconds, Ansix Tech has carved a reputation for delivering high-performance PET cylindrical cover flanges that balance durability with cost-effectiveness, mastering the complex dance between polymer science and manufacturing innovation.

PET cylindrical cover flanges are a cornerstone component in modern packaging and industrial applications, serving as the critical sealing interface for containers, electronic housings, and fluid systems. These flanges must withstand mechanical stresses, maintain dimensional stability, and often comply with strict regulatory standards—particularly in food contact and technical applications.

 

The global shift toward sustainable, recyclable packaging has propelled PET (polyethylene terephthalate) to the forefront of material choices, creating both opportunities and technical challenges for manufacturers like Ansix Tech. Achieving perfection in these components requires navigating a complex landscape of material behavior, precision engineering, and process optimization.

 

1 Market Context and Design Imperatives

The demand for PET cylindrical cover flanges spans multiple industries, from beverage packaging where they serve as tamper-evident seals, to technical applications in electronics and automotive systems where they function as protective housings and connection interfaces. The European Union's directive requiring fixed-attachment caps on plastic bottles illustrates the evolving regulatory landscape that drives design innovation in this sector.

 

For cylindrical cover flanges, the design priorities are multidimensional. First, they must provide reliable sealing performance under varying pressure conditions—whether containing carbonated beverages or protecting sensitive electronics from environmental contaminants. Second, they require precise dimensional control to ensure compatibility with mating components, often involving threaded connections or snap-fit assemblies that demand exacting tolerances. Finally, aesthetic considerations cannot be overlooked, as surface finish, clarity, and absence of defects directly impact perceived quality in consumer-facing applications.

 

The engineering specifications for these components typically call for uniform wall thickness—usually between 1.5mm and 3.0mm depending on diameter—to ensure consistent cooling and minimize warpage. Design features often include integrated hinge mechanisms for flip-top closures, breakaway tamper-evident bands, and precision threads with strict pitch and lead angle requirements. These complex geometries present significant challenges in mold design and filling dynamics that Ansix Tech has systematically addressed through years of specialized experience.

 

2 Material Science: Selecting the Right PET Grade

PET's dominance in cylindrical cover flange applications stems from its unique combination of properties: excellent clarity when amorphous, strong barrier properties against moisture and gases, good chemical resistance, and favorable processing characteristics. Unlike polyolefins, PET maintains its dimensional stability under load, making it ideal for threaded components that must resist creep deformation over time.

 

The selection process at Ansix Tech begins with a thorough analysis of the component's functional requirements and operating environment. For food-contact applications, FDA-compliant grades with appropriate thermal stabilizers are mandatory. For technical applications requiring enhanced mechanical properties, glass-filled or mineral-reinforced PET compounds offer improved stiffness and reduced coefficient of thermal expansion.

 

Material shrinkage behavior represents a critical consideration, as PET exhibits anisotropic shrinkage—differing in flow and transverse directions—which must be compensated for in mold design. "Understanding how a specific PET grade will shrink in your particular geometry is fundamental to achieving precision parts," explains Dr. Li Wen, Ansix Tech's Head of Materials Science. "We've developed proprietary predictive models that account for both material characteristics and flow patterns specific to cylindrical geometries."

 

3 Mold Design and Engineering Excellence

The mold represents the heart of precision injection molding, and for cylindrical cover flanges, it embodies a symphony of engineering solutions addressing unique challenges. Ansix Tech's mold design philosophy centers on balanced filling, efficient cooling, and controlled ejection—three pillars essential for producing consistent, high-quality parts at competitive cycle times.

 

The runner and gate system requires particular attention for cylindrical components. Pin-point gates often serve best for symmetrical parts, while diaphragm gates may be employed for components requiring maximum dimensional stability. Gate location is strategically determined using advanced flow simulation to minimize weld lines in critical stress areas and ensure uniform filling of the circular geometry.

 

Cooling presents special challenges with cylindrical parts due to the difficulty of positioning efficient cooling channels around circular cavities. Ansix Tech employs conformal cooling channels—created through additive manufacturing techniques—that follow the contour of the cavity at a consistent distance, dramatically improving cooling efficiency and reducing cycle times by up to 30% compared to conventional straight-drilled channels. This approach also minimizes thermal gradients that can cause warpage in thin-walled circular components.

 

The ejection system must carefully balance sufficient force to remove the part without causing distortion, particularly for deep-draw cylindrical geometries. Ansix Tech utilizes a combination of ejector pins, sleeves, and stripper plates tailored to each component's geometry. For flanges with undercuts or internal threads, collapsible cores or unscrewing mechanisms are engineered with precision to ensure reliable cycling over hundreds of thousands of shots.

4 Production Challenges and Process Optimization

Manufacturing PET cylindrical cover flanges presents unique challenges stemming from PET's crystallization behavior and sensitivity to processing conditions. Unlike amorphous polymers that gradually soften when heated, PET has a sharp melting point and can undergo rapid crystallization if cooled too slowly, leading to cloudiness and brittleness in what should be clear, tough components.

 

One primary challenge involves managing the differential shrinkage between the flange's radial and axial dimensions. Circular geometries tend to shrink more in the circumferential direction, potentially causing ovality or diameter variations. Ansix Tech addresses this through precise control of packing pressure profiles and cooling rates, using cavity pressure sensors to verify process consistency shot-to-shot.

 

Process optimization follows a structured validation methodology comprising Installation Qualification (IQ), Operational Qualification (OQ), and Performance Qualification (PQ). During OQ, process windows are established for critical parameters including melt temperature (typically 260-285°C for PET), injection speed, packing pressure, and cooling time. "We don't just find a single set of parameters that works," notes production manager Zhang Wei. "We map the entire operating envelope to understand how variations affect quality, which allows us to maintain consistency despite normal material and environmental fluctuations."

 

Cycle time reduction represents a crucial component of cost control. Through strategic mold design and process optimization, Ansix Tech has achieved average cycle time reductions of 15-25% for PET cylindrical components compared to industry benchmarks. Key strategies include optimized cooling channel design, reduced injection times through balanced filling, and minimized packing phases through scientific determination of gate freeze-off time.

 

5 Quality Assurance and Cost-Efficiency Strategy

Quality control for cylindrical cover flanges extends beyond dimensional verification to encompass functional testing of sealing performance, thread engagement, and mechanical integrity. Ansix Tech employs a multi-tiered inspection protocol beginning with in-machine vision systems that check 100% of parts for gross defects, followed by statistical sampling for detailed dimensional analysis using coordinate measuring machines (CMMs).

 

Critical dimensions including outer diameter, thread pitch, flange flatness, and wall thickness are monitored using control charts that track process capability indices (Cp and Cpk). For high-precision applications, these indices typically exceed 1.67, indicating a process capable of maintaining tolerances within ±0.05mm for diameters under 50mm.

 

The economic advantages delivered to clients stem from a comprehensive value-engineering approach spanning the entire production lifecycle:

 

Material Optimization: Through careful grade selection and regrind management strategies, Ansix Tech minimizes material costs without compromising performance. For non-critical applications, strategic use of regrind can reduce material expenses by 10-15% while maintaining required properties.

 

Process Efficiency: The combination of conformal cooling, optimized injection parameters, and automated post-processing reduces cycle times and labor requirements, directly translating to lower per-part costs.

 

Design for Manufacturing: Early collaboration with clients to refine designs for manufacturability eliminates costly downstream modifications. "We've helped numerous clients simplify complex flange designs by suggesting subtle geometry changes that maintain function while dramatically improving moldability," explains lead engineer Maria Chen.

 

Preventive Maintenance: A rigorous mold maintenance schedule extends tool life and prevents unplanned downtime, ensuring consistent production flow and on-time delivery.

 

6 The Path to Market: Rapid Delivery Protocols

In today's fast-paced market environment, speed-to-market represents a competitive advantage that Ansix Tech has systematically cultivated. The company's integrated digital workflow connects design, simulation, manufacturing, and quality verification into a seamless process that can deliver functional prototypes in as little as two weeks and production tooling within 4-6 weeks for standard cylindrical flange molds.

 

This accelerated timeline begins with concurrent engineering practices where mold design commences alongside final part design validation. Advanced simulation tools predict filling patterns, cooling efficiency, and potential warpage before steel is cut, reducing trial-and-error iterations. Modern machining technologies including high-speed CNC milling, EDM, and laser texturing further compress the fabrication timeline while improving accuracy.

 

For time-critical projects, Ansix Tech offers a rapid prototyping pathway using aluminum molds for initial production runs of 500-5,000 parts, allowing market testing and design verification before committing to hardened steel production tooling. This phased approach mitigates risk while accelerating overall development schedules.

 

Supply chain integration further enhances delivery reliability. Strategic partnerships with material suppliers ensure consistent resin quality and availability, while in-house secondary operations (including precision machining, assembly, and packaging) eliminate external dependencies that could delay fulfillment.
